Built in 1893, the Hooper Building is a National Historic Landmark featuring Queen Anne-style architecture and seven floors of contemporary office suites, privates offices, and coworking space. Located at the heart of Downtown Cincinnati within the West Fourth Street Historic District, this red-brick building offers easy access to the Central Business District as well as the dining and entertainment options of The Banks.
Conveniently situated within Downtown Cincinnati in the West Fourth Street Historic District, the Hooper Building is located just a block from the Duke Energy Convention Center and within walking distance of The Banks and Smale Riverfront Park. Commuting to the office is a breeze with the Fountain Square streetcar station just three blocks away. Easy access to I-71 and I-75 make driving to and from the center simple, and car commuters will find ample parking within three blocks of the building.
